Abstract:
Thermosetting resinous moulding compositions comprise (A) 10 to 70 parts by weight of a finely-divided solid filler of average particle size below 1 micron and (B) 90 to 30 parts of a polyester resin derived by heating above 150 DEG C. but not exceeding 250 DEG C. (a) one mol. of at least one unsaturated dicarboxylic acid selected from fumaric acid, maleic acid, maleic anhydride, citraconic acid and citraconic anhydride; (b) 3 to 5 mols. of adipic acid; (c) 7 to 9 mols. of succinic acid; (d) 0.5 to 5 mols. of propylene glycol; and (e) 14 to 9 mols. of ethylene glycol, the glycols providing at least 5 but not over 15 per cent numerical excess of hydroxyl over carboxyl groups. Up to 20 mol. per cent of the glycols may be replaced by higher glycols, e.g. diethylene glycol, 1,3-butylene glycol, triethylene glycol and neopentylene glycol, and 0.1 to 0.75 mols. of glycerol may also be included. Specified fillers are silica, calcium carbonate, aluminium silicate, magnesium silicate, talc, iron oxides, diatomaceous earth, hydrated alumina, hydrated silicates, mica, kaolin, bentonite and glass. The filler particles may be coated with resins, e.g. a melamine resin, soaps, e.g. aluminium and magnesium stearates, oils, e.g. tall oil, or fatty acids, e.g. stearic acid. Up to 30 per cent of the filler may be replaced by fibrous materials, e.g. asbestos, cotton, nylon, acrylonitrile resin and glass fibres. Plasticisers, e.g. tricresyl phosphate and dioctyl phthalate, inhibitors, e.g. hydroquinone, resorcinol, tannin, sym-alpha, beta-naphthyl p-phenylene diamine and N-phenyl-beta-naphthylamine, and, prior to use, catalysts, e.g. benzoyl peroxide, tertiary butyl hydroperoxide, ditertiary butyl peroxide, tertiary butyl perbenzoate and ditertiary butyl diperphthalate, may be added. The compositions may be used to form electrical insulation.
